Enterprise Value to Operating Cash Flow (EV/OCF) ratio compares a company`s total enterprise value to its operating cash flow. It shows how much investors are paying for each dollar of the company`s operating cash flow, including both equity and debt.

Glance View

Mid-America Apartment Communities Inc., often recognized by its ticker symbol MAA, stands out in the real estate investment trust (REIT) universe. Established in 1994 and headquartered in Memphis, Tennessee, the company has carved a niche for itself as a key player in the multifamily housing sector. MAA operates an extensive portfolio of high-quality apartment communities across the United States, largely concentrated in the Sunbelt region. This geographic focus taps into the burgeoning demand driven by the influx of population and economic growth in areas such as Texas, Florida, and North Carolina. MAA thrives by strategically acquiring, developing, and renovating properties, maintaining a sharp focus on middle-market segments appealing to both millennials seeking dynamic urban environments and retirees leaning toward warmer climes. A systematic operational approach underpins MAA's financial success. The company derives revenue primarily from leasing apartment units, which involves not just straightforward tenant rental payments but also ancillary charges such as pet fees, parking, and additional service offerings. Moreover, MAA emphasizes cost control and operational efficiency, leveraging technology and data analytics to streamline property management and enhance resident satisfaction. This attention to operational excellence allows MAA to enjoy stable cash flows, supporting the company's commitment to rewarding shareholders through consistent dividend payments. Crucial to maintaining competitive advantage, MAA constantly aligns its strategies with shifting market trends and demographic preferences, ensuring sustained growth and value creation in the dynamic real estate landscape.
